STRUCTURE_DATA

Request the printing of special structure data during a structure optimization (in MOTION%PRINT) or when setting up a subsys (in SUBSYS%PRINT). [Edit on GitHub]

ADD_LAST

Type: enum
Default: NO
Usage: ADD_LAST (NO|NUMERIC|SYMBOLIC)

Description: If the last iteration should be added, and if it should be marked symbolically (with lowercase letter l) or with the iteration number. Not every iteration level is able to identify the last iteration early enough to be able to output. When this keyword is activated all iteration levels are checked for the last iteration step.

Valid values:

  • NO Do not mark last iteration specifically

  • NUMERIC Mark last iteration with its iteration number

  • SYMBOLIC Mark last iteration with lowercase letter l

DIHEDRAL_ANGLE

Type: integer[4]
Repeatable: yes
Aliases: DIHEDRAL, DIH
Usage: DIHEDRAL_ANGLE {integer} {integer} {integer} {integer}

Description: Print the dihedral angle between the planes defined by the atoms (a,b,c) and the atoms (b,c,d) specified by their indices

FILENAME

Type: string
Default: __STD_OUT__
Usage: FILENAME ./filename

Description: controls part of the filename for output. use __STD_OUT__ (exactly as written here) for the screen or standard logger. use filename to obtain projectname-filename. use ./filename to get filename. A middle name (if present), iteration numbers and extension are always added to the filename. if you want to avoid it use =filename, in this case the filename is always exactly as typed. Please note that this can lead to clashes of filenames.
